window fabrication equipment
Window fabrication equipment represents a comprehensive suite of specialized machinery designed to manufacture high-quality windows with precision and efficiency. These advanced systems integrate cutting, welding, milling, and assembly technologies to transform raw materials such as PVC profiles, aluminum extrusions, and glass panels into finished window products. The primary functions of window fabrication equipment include profile cutting to exact dimensions, corner cleaning to prepare joints for welding, seamless welding of frame corners, precision milling to create smooth surfaces, hardware installation for operational components, and glass processing for perfect fits. Modern window fabrication equipment incorporates computer numerical control systems that ensure repeatable accuracy across thousands of production cycles, minimizing material waste and maximizing output quality. The technological features of contemporary window fabrication equipment include servo-driven motors for precise positioning, automated feeding systems that reduce manual handling, digital touch-screen interfaces for intuitive operation, and integrated safety mechanisms that protect operators during production processes. These machines can process various window styles including casement, sliding, tilt-and-turn, and fixed configurations, accommodating different architectural requirements and design preferences.
